Q » How does a tensile structure carry loads?

A » A tensile structure carries loads through tension, which involves stretching materials such as fabric, cables, or membranes to distribute forces evenly across the structure. This approach contrasts with traditional compression-based systems like columns or beams. By leveraging lightweight, flexible materials, tensile structures achieve stability and strength, efficiently transferring loads to anchoring points, creating innovative architectural forms with minimal material usage.

A »A tensile structure carries loads through its membrane or fabric, which is stretched between supports, distributing tension forces evenly. The curved shape and prestressing of the membrane enable it to resist external loads, such as wind and snow, by transferring them to the supporting elements, like masts or cables, and ultimately to the foundation.
